About ZIP Code 66205

ZIP code 66205 is located in Mission, Kansas, within Johnson County. With a population of 13,728, this is a lightly populated ZIP code with a relatively young community — the median age is 37 years. Economically, 66205 is a upper-middle-income ZIP code: the median household income of $100,139 is above the national average.

Real estate in ZIP code 66205 represents a mid-range housing market. The median home value of $341,500 is above the national average. Renters can expect to pay around $1,639 per month in median rent. Homeownership is strong here — 75.6% of occupied units are owner-occupied, suggesting an established, stable residential community. Median home values have increased by 49% since 2019.

The population of 66205 is primarily White (79.52%). Residents are highly educated — 71.1% hold a bachelor's degree or higher, which is significantly above the national average. Poverty affects a relatively small share of residents at 7.7%. Household income has grown by 15% since 2019.

The unemployment rate in 66205 stands at 2.6%, which is below the national average. About 17% of workers are remote. As in most parts of the country, driving alone is the dominant commute mode at 77%.

Overall, ZIP code 66205 in Mission, KS is characterized as upper-middle-income, highly educated, a relatively young community, and predominantly owner-occupied.
